Ingredients

2 cups Coarse Gram flour (Magas/Laddu Besan)
1 cup Ghee, pure
1 cup Powdered sugar
1/4 cup Milk
1/2 tsp Cardamom powder
2 tbsp Melon seeds (Magajtari)
1 tbsp Sliced almonds

Tips & Secrets

  • Using the 'Dhabo' technique is mandatory for achieving the most professional-grade authentic 'Magas' granules that melt in your mouth.
  • Ensuring the roasted flour is only slightly warm before adding sugar provides the absolute secret to achieving superior professional-grade soft-bite quality.
  • The addition of a little saffron-infused milk provides the essential professional-grade royal-aroma lift.
  • Always use melon seeds (Magajtari) specifically to ensure the signature professional-grade traditional look is maintained.
